The National Pantheon of Heroes in Asunción, Paraguay, is a significant historical and architectural landmark dedicated to the nation's heroes. This mausoleum, inspired by Les Invalides in Paris, houses the remains of notable Paraguayan figures. A visit typically lasts about an hour, allowing time to appreciate the architecture and learn about the historical figures honored within. Accessibility is generally good, though some areas may present challenges for those with mobility issues. Exploring the Pantheon solo is feasible, as there are informational plaques and guides available; however, a guided tour can provide deeper historical context. There are no significant seasonal restrictions affecting visits. The entrance is free, though donations are appreciated to help maintain the site. Overall, it offers a worthwhile cultural experience and insight into Paraguayan history.
